Prioritize Regular Maintenance
An RV is your home on wheels, so you need to take care of it just as you do your house to keep it functioning and preserve its value. Inspect key elements like seals, plumbing systems, and electrical connections. One crucial yet often overlooked step is ensuring your RV’s roof is in excellent condition. Inspecting the roof regularly can prevent leaks and extend the overall lifespan of your RV.
Optimize Your Space Wisely
Thoughtful organization can make a world of difference in an RV. Think about the items that genuinely enhance your experience on the road and prioritize those. Overpacking can ruin the joy of traveling by cluttering your living areas and reducing functional space.
Each item in your RV should serve a practical purpose or bring you joy. Invest in space-saving solutions like collapsible cookware, stackable containers, or multi-purpose furniture to make the most of your limited square footage. Small yet intentional improvements in interior organization can lead to a more comfortable and stress-free experience.
Plan Your Trips but Stay Flexible
Successful RV trips often strike a balance between planning and spontaneity. While planning your route ensures you don’t miss key attractions or show up at fully booked campgrounds, leaving room for changes allows you to soak up unexpected opportunities.
Build a Connection With the RV Community
One of the most enriching aspects of RV ownership is being part of a passionate, vibrant community of fellow adventurers. Joining local and online groups can provide you with new ideas for travel destinations, advice on maintenance, or even recommendations for the best campgrounds.
Participating in gatherings or meetups enriches your experience further. The shared camaraderie of RV living fosters a sense of belonging and offers an opportunity to build lasting memories with like-minded enthusiasts.
